Short answer: no. Long answer: noooooooo. Alright, but really, Children of the Corn, or Corner was named by Big L and it was essentially Mase and Lגs group (though L would come through after tracks were done a lot of the time and just add his verse or whatever) but at the core of that and what had started first, was Caged Fury, which was Digga, Kam and Bloodshed, CamגRonגs now deceased cousin (due to a car wreck if you didnגt know). So Digga has been trying to drop Caged Fury material for a minute but גnobody will put it outג. He said when he finds a label that will release it, itגll come out. One of the first times anyone heard Mase (or Kam) was on Stretch & Bobbitoגs show back in December of ג93. So around then was basically the start of Children of the Corn.Dragondude R wrote:is BBO the same as Caged Fury (blood, cam, digga)? first i ever heard of them
BBO on the other hand, actually has material out, as you can see and is mostly Maseגs group (though of course he left for stardom and then they gave him props, floundered and disappeared around ג99). However, very little is known (at least from my searches online) about BBO, sometimes known as BBO Enterprises, BBO Crew or BBO Niggas (or Niggaz) (on certain bootlegs). Big L gave them a couple shout outs, both back in the ג93/ג94 era:
גג¦peace to Mase Murder and the B.B.O. crew, the Best Out crew, the M&M crew and all the other crews thatגs representinג in Harlem, you know what Iגm sayinג? And last but not least, I gotta say peace to the hundred thirty ninth street N.F.L. crew, my crew, word up.ג - 8 Iz Enuff (album version).
"Ay I gotta say peace to the N.F.L. crew, the B.B.O. crew, you know what Iגm sayinג, gotta say peace to Big Twan, you know what Iגm sayinג, his man Terra, the whole eastside assassins man, everybody." - '93 Stretch & Bobbito (interview).
Mase mentions them along with the NFL (Niggaz For Life) crew at the end of '93's Drug Wars.
And he had a freestyle called Get Rude in ג93 and the interesting thing is there is a verse from Pose a Threat in the ג94 Stretch & Bobbito Children of the Corn freestyle session, so there is some overlap. Get Rude and Pose a Threat were both later recorded on wax by BBO and released in ג96.

BBO was 4 or 5 niggas not 3
Blinky Blink (Mase brother also of Harlem World)
Napizm
White Bread
Beef Tha Thief
& I think this dude called Futuristic
they had ads in the Source & everything for their debut lp "Across from 115th St" but obviously that never dropped
